<div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div dir="ltr"><div class="gmail_quote"><div dir="ltr" class="gmail_attr">On Tue, Feb 19, 2019 at 12:38 AM Cole Robinson <<a href="mailto:crobinso@redhat.com">crobinso@redhat.com</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left:1px solid rgb(204,204,204);padding-left:1ex">On 2/17/19 10:57 AM, Daniel Kasak wrote:<br>
> On Sat, Feb 9, 2019 at 2:05 AM Cole Robinson <<a href="mailto:crobinso@redhat.com" target="_blank">crobinso@redhat.com</a><br>
> <mailto:<a href="mailto:crobinso@redhat.com" target="_blank">crobinso@redhat.com</a>>> wrote:<br>
> <br>
>     On 2/8/19 7:49 PM, Daniel Kasak wrote:<br>
>     > I've changed the following from the default:<br>
>     ><br>
>     > Display Spice:<br>
>     >  - Listen type<br>
>     >     - Default ( Address ) - no matter what other options I choose with<br>
>     > this, I get "SPICE GL support is local-only ..."<br>
>     >     - None - I get "Error starting domain: internal error: qemu<br>
>     > unexpectedly closed the monitor"<br>
>     ><br>
> <br>
>     This last bit should be the working config, but that error means<br>
>     something went wrong launching qemu. pastebin your<br>
>     /var/log/libvirt/qemu/$vmname.log and I will check<br>
> <br>
> <br>
> It's taken a while to figure out exactly what's going on here ... there<br>
> are *no* logs in that directory. But I caught systemd logging:<br>
>   Process 15334 (qemu-system-x86) of user 1000 dumped core.<br>
>  ... each time I tried to start the VM.<br>
> <br>
> I've tried with qemu-3.1.0 and qemu built from git.<br>
> <br>
> Is there a way to get virt-manager to spit out the exact command line<br>
> it's using to invoke qemu?<br>
<br>
Are you using qemu:///session maybe? Then the logs will be in<br>
~/.cache/libvirt/qemu/log/ . The log file is the the canonical location<br>
to find the qemu command line that libvirt is generating<br></blockquote><div><br></div><div>Aha. I have the command-line now. Thanks :) Full log:</div></div><div class="gmail_quote"><br></div><div class="gmail_quote">---</div><div class="gmail_quote"><br></div><div class="gmail_quote">2019-02-18 12:23:45.437+0000: starting up libvirt version: 5.0.0, qemu version: 3.1.50v3.1.0-1836-g1e36232994-dirty, kernel: 5.0.0-rc4, hostname: nanginator<br>LC_ALL=C \<br>PATH=/home/dkasak/Applications/.bin:/opt/efl/bin:/usr/lib/llvm/7/bin:/opt/e22/bin:/opt/rocm/bin/: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/opt/bin \<br>HOME=/home/dkasak \<br>USER=dkasak \<br>LOGNAME=dkasak \<br>QEMU_AUDIO_DRV=spice \<br>/usr/bin/qemu-system-x86_64 \<br>-name guest=Android-x86,debug-threads=on \<br>-S \<br>-object secret,id=masterKey0,format=raw,file=/home/dkasak/.config/libvirt/qemu/lib/domain-1-Android-x86/master-key.aes \<br>-machine pc-i440fx-3.1,accel=tcg,usb=off,vmport=off,dump-guest-core=off \<br>-cpu kvm64 \<br>-m 1024 \<br>-realtime mlock=off \<br>-smp 2,sockets=2,cores=1,threads=1 \<br>-uuid 3e432cc9-8ce8-4089-912f-8ef50d9a9c8a \<br>-no-user-config \<br>-nodefaults \<br>-chardev socket,id=charmonitor,fd=20,server,nowait \<br>-mon chardev=charmonitor,id=monitor,mode=control \<br>-rtc base=utc,driftfix=slew \<br>-global kvm-pit.lost_tick_policy=delay \<br>-no-hpet \<br>-no-shutdown \<br>-global PIIX4_PM.disable_s3=1 \<br>-global PIIX4_PM.disable_s4=1 \<br>-boot strict=on \<br>-device ich9-usb-ehci1,id=usb,bus=pci.0,addr=0x5.0x7 \<br>-device ich9-usb-uhci1,masterbus=usb.0,firstport=0,bus=pci.0,multifunction=on,addr=0x5 \<br>-device ich9-usb-uhci2,masterbus=usb.0,firstport=2,bus=pci.0,addr=0x5.0x1 \<br>-device ich9-usb-uhci3,masterbus=usb.0,firstport=4,bus=pci.0,addr=0x5.0x2 \<br>-drive file=/home/dkasak/.local/share/libvirt/images/Android-x86.qcow2,format=qcow2,if=none,id=drive-ide0-0-0 \<br>-device ide-hd,bus=ide.0,unit=0,drive=drive-ide0-0-0,id=ide0-0-0,bootindex=1 \<br>-drive if=none,id=drive-ide0-0-1,readonly=on \<br>-device ide-cd,bus=ide.0,unit=1,drive=drive-ide0-0-1,id=ide0-0-1 \<br>-netdev user,id=hostnet0 \<br>-device e1000,netdev=hostnet0,id=net0,mac=52:54:00:74:b8:ea,bus=pci.0,addr=0x3 \<br>-chardev pty,id=charserial0 \<br>-device isa-serial,chardev=charserial0,id=serial0 \<br>-device usb-tablet,id=input0,bus=usb.0,port=1 \<br>-spice port=0,disable-ticketing,image-compression=off,gl=on,rendernode=/dev/dri/renderD128,seamless-migration=on \<br>-device virtio-vga,id=video0,virgl=on,max_outputs=1,bus=pci.0,addr=0x2 \<br>-device intel-hda,id=sound0,bus=pci.0,addr=0x4 \<br>-device hda-duplex,id=sound0-codec0,bus=sound0.0,cad=0 \<br>-chardev spicevmc,id=charredir0,name=usbredir \<br>-device usb-redir,chardev=charredir0,id=redir0,bus=usb.0,port=2 \<br>-chardev spicevmc,id=charredir1,name=usbredir \<br>-device usb-redir,chardev=charredir1,id=redir1,bus=usb.0,port=3 \<br>-device virtio-balloon-pci,id=balloon0,bus=pci.0,addr=0x6 \<br>-sandbox on,obsolete=deny,elevateprivileges=deny,spawn=deny,resourcecontrol=deny \<br>-msg timestamp=on<br>char device redirected to /dev/pts/7 (label charserial0)<br>2019-02-18 12:23:45.665+0000: shutting down, reason=failed<br></div><div class="gmail_quote"><br></div><div class="gmail_quote">---</div><div class="gmail_quote"><br></div><div class="gmail_quote">If I run that command directly, I get:</div><div class="gmail_quote"><br></div><div class="gmail_quote">2019-02-18T12:36:09.947298Z qemu-system-x86_64: -object secret,id=masterKey0,format=raw,file=/home/dkasak/.config/libvirt/qemu/lib/domain-1-Android-x86/master-key.aes: Unable to read /home/dkasak/.config/libvirt/qemu/lib/domain-1-Android-x86/master-key.aes: Failed to open file “/home/dkasak/.config/libvirt/qemu/lib/domain-1-Android-x86/master-key.aes”: No such file or directory</div><div class="gmail_quote"><br></div><div class="gmail_quote">If I remove the line that mentions master-key.aes, I get:</div><div class="gmail_quote"><br></div><div class="gmail_quote">2019-02-18T12:36:54.112944Z qemu-system-x86_64: -chardev socket,id=charmonitor,fd=20,server,nowait: File descriptor '20' is not a socket</div><div class="gmail_quote"><br></div><div class="gmail_quote">If I remove the line that mentions fd=20, I get:</div><div class="gmail_quote"><br></div><div class="gmail_quote">char device redirected to /dev/pts/7 (label charserial0)<br>./run.sh: line 49: 31512 Bad system call         (core dumped) LC_ALL=C PATH=/home/dkasak/Applications/.bin:/opt/efl/bin:/usr/lib/llvm/7/bin:/opt/e22/bin:/opt/rocm/bin/: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/opt/bin HOME=/home/dkasak USER=dkasak LOGNAME=dkasak QEMU_AUDIO_DRV=spice /usr/bin/qemu-system-x86_64 -name guest=Android-x86,debug-threads=on -S -machine pc-i440fx-3.1,accel=tcg,usb=off,vmport=off,dump-guest-core=off -cpu kvm64 -m 1024 -realtime mlock=off -smp 2,sockets=2,cores=1,threads=1 -uuid 3e432cc9-8ce8-4089-912f-8ef50d9a9c8a -no-user-config -nodefaults -m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c,driftfix=slew -global kvm-pit.lost_tick_policy=delay -no-hpet -no-shutdown -global PIIX4_PM.disable_s3=1 -global PIIX4_PM.disable_s4=1 -boot strict=on -device ich9-usb-ehci1,id=usb,bus=pci.0,addr=0x5.0x7 -device ich9-usb-uhci1,masterbus=usb.0,firstport=0,bus=pci.0,multifunction=on,addr=0x5 -device ich9-usb-uhci2,masterbus=usb.0,firstport=2,bus=pci.0,addr=0x5.0x1 -device ich9-usb-uhci3,masterbus=usb.0,firstport=4,bus=pci.0,addr=0x5.0x2 -drive file=/home/dkasak/.local/share/libvirt/images/Android-x86.qcow2,format=qcow2,if=none,id=drive-ide0-0-0 -device ide-hd,bus=ide.0,unit=0,drive=drive-ide0-0-0,id=ide0-0-0,bootindex=1 -drive if=none,id=drive-ide0-0-1,readonly=on -device ide-cd,bus=ide.0,unit=1,drive=drive-ide0-0-1,id=ide0-0-1 -netdev user,id=hostnet0 -device e1000,netdev=hostnet0,id=net0,mac=52:54:00:74:b8:ea,bus=pci.0,addr=0x3 -chardev pty,id=charserial0 -device isa-serial,chardev=charserial0,id=serial0 -device usb-tablet,id=input0,bus=usb.0,port=1 -spice port=0,disable-ticketing,image-compression=off,gl=on,rendernode=/dev/dri/renderD128,seamless-migration=on -device virtio-vga,id=video0,virgl=on,max_outputs=1,bus=pci.0,addr=0x2 -device intel-hda,id=sound0,bus=pci.0,addr=0x4 -device hda-duplex,id=sound0-codec0,bus=sound0.0,cad=0 -chardev spicevmc,id=charredir0,name=usbredir -device usb-redir,chardev=charredir0,id=redir0,bus=usb.0,port=2 -chardev spicevmc,id=charredir1,name=usbredir -device usb-redir,chardev=charredir1,id=redir1,bus=usb.0,port=3 -device virtio-balloon-pci,id=balloon0,bus=pci.0,addr=0x6 -sandbox on,obsolete=deny,elevateprivileges=deny,spawn=deny,resourcecontrol=deny -msg timestamp=on<br></div><div class="gmail_quote"><br></div><div class="gmail_quote">Dan<br></div></div></div></div></div></div>